Benefits of Choosing Dedicated Capacity Across Florida
The advantages of full truckload logistics go beyond speed. Dedicated moves typically offer better load integrity because fewer touchpoints reduce the risk of shifting or damage. You also gain tighter control over pickup and delivery coordination, Boat Transport which can align with dock availability and appointment requirements. For time-sensitive commodities, full truckload services can improve operational flow by keeping planning centralized and communication streamlined from origin to destination.
